2011-07-19 23 views
0

我是Sencha touch的新手,我需要解析一個xml文件。 我可以顯示標籤之間的數據,但我不能顯示數據時,我有一個屬性。我如何閱讀xml項目的屬性?

一些身體可以幫助我please.Thanks用於提前

+0

原諒我,我會接受回答我以前的問題 –

回答

0

你可以用在你的領域定義的映射屬性。

Ext.define('temp.model.User', { 
    extend: 'Ext.data.Model', 

    config: { 
     fields: [ 
      { name: 'pseudo', type: 'string', mapping: '@pseudo' }, 
      { name: 'id',  type: 'int' }, 
      { name: 'name', type: 'string' }, 
     ]  
    } 
}); 

將讀取該XML:

<?xml version="1.0" encoding="UTF-8"?> 
<users> 
    <user pseudo="pierre"> 
    <id>1</id> 
    <name>Pierre</name> 
    </user> 
    <user pseudo="zorg"> 
    <id>99</id> 
    <name>Zorglub</name> 
    </user> 
</users> 

我知道這是一個古老的職位,但因爲我發現這個問題尋找答案的時候......